Output 3e75af39ef17c764fd0e6a3ed007d46033c4f807b2e11ab2a5b5e8e93ff7af03:8

value
3488000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f0c117015f149b54173aa1ae4f605950c4fac87 OP_EQUAL
address
A2ZS8Bzc1d7nKSHbT4jjvJht2gjMuvKCqK
transaction
3e75af39ef17c764fd0e6a3ed007d46033c4f807b2e11ab2a5b5e8e93ff7af03